  • Quadro 5000 has 204% more power consumption, than Radeon 550X.
  • Quadro 5000 is connected by PCIe 2.0 x16, and Radeon 550X uses PCIe 3.0 x8 interface.
  • Quadro 5000 and Radeon 550X have maximum RAM of 2 GB.
  • Both cards are used in Desktops.
  • Quadro 5000 is build with Fermi architecture, and Radeon 550X - with GCN 4.0.
  • Core clock speed of Radeon 550X is 569 MHz higher, than Quadro 5000.
  • Quadro 5000 is manufactured by 40 nm process technology, and Radeon 550X - by 14 nm process technology.
  • Quadro 5000 is 103 mm longer, than Radeon 550X.
  • Memory clock speed of Radeon 550X is 4000 MHz higher, than Quadro 5000.
